Dana Bourgeois and co have nailed the recipe for a dynamite Dreadnought here: quick and responsive, lots of bark, with an easy playability and a classic look. This beau was built for the 2008 IBMA, number two of six, and comes to us with premium Brazilian Rosewood back and sides, Adirondack Spruce on top, and a soft V neck that’s super easy to play. With a few years under its belt, this Bourgeois D-150 has opened up nicely, and we love the sweet flavor of the trebles, and the clean, refined bass response. That last detail helps separate this D-150 from other Dreads, giving the overall voice added clarity and definition.
